Products JavaScript Script

Export HTML Tables to Excel



Product Details

  • document With documentation
  • browser Cross-browser compatible
  • chat Support included
  • Lifetime access Lifetime access to updates

Use this script in your JavaScript application to easily export your HTML tables to Excel with various approaches. Simply copy the provided functions into your codebase, and you can start exporting tables in your application.

This product comes with the following features:

  • Supports multiple approaches: The script supports multiple approaches for exporting HTML tables. Trigger programmatically, automatically add an Export button to one or all of your tables, or use HTML data attributes to mark tables as exportable. You can read more about the implementation in the documentation to see how to use the functions.
  • Easy to configure: Using function parameters, you can select which table you want to export, dynamically set your exported file’s name, and configure the export button’s label.
  • Cross-browser support: The script was tested on major browsers (Chrome, Firefox, Edge) to ensure cross-browser compatibility.
  • No third-party dependency: The script is written in vanilla JavaScript, making it performant and lightweight compared to other solutions. There are no dependencies on other packages.


This product include detailed documentation with code examples on how to set up the code, how to use its API, and how to integrate it seamlessly into your existing software ecosystems.

Read more



This product hasn't been rated yet. Lead the way! Your review fuels informed decisions. Share your insights now.



Other Questions

Do you have other questions you can’t find the answer for? Contact us!

Contact Us
Do you offer support or updates for purchased items? +
We provide 30 days of support from the date of purchase for each product. We also regularly audit our product catalog to keep products up to date and ensure they work with the latest version of their dependencies. New features are also often added to existing products. After purchasing a product, you'll also gain access to future updates.
Can I request customizations or modifications to the code? +
Yes! You can file a request for a purchased product using our contact page, and we'll get in touch with you. Customizations and modifications to your product purchase are subject to additional fees, which are determined on an individual basis based on the complexity of your request.
How do you ensure code quality? +
We're committed to providing high-quality products and ensuring our customers are satisfied with their purchases. To maintain our product's code quality at a high standard, each codebase goes through multiple rounds of reviews before publication. Products are also tested with static code analysis tools, linters, and where appropriate, we also provide unit and E2E tests with our products.
Are there any refunds or return policies in place? +
We provide a 14-day refund period starting from the date of purchase. For more information on eligibility for a refund and how to request one, please consult our Refund Policy
Do you provide documentation or tutorials for using the code? +
Most of our products include detailed documentation with code examples on how to set up the code, how to use its API, and how to integrate it seamlessly into your existing software ecosystems. If you believe one of our product's documentation is missing a subject, please get in touch through our contact page so we can improve it.

Recommended Products

Verified Hire a Developer

Need help with your project or looking for code you can't find?
Get connected to our top developers to assist you with your custom requirements.

Get in touch
  • html
  • css
  • javascript
  • typescript
  • react
  • svelte
  • astro
  • sass
Technologies we use and recommend

Thank you for your interest in this product! Currently, it's still in development. To get notified about its release, please provide your email address below.

This site uses cookies We use cookies to understand visitors and create a better experience for you. By clicking on "Accept", you accept its use. To find out more, please see our privacy policy.